Ruby on Rails vs. Various other Frameworks: A Thorough Comparison

When it comes to web development structures, developers are spoiled for selection. Ruby on Rails (RoR), Django, Laravel, and Node.js are a few of one of the most popular structures readily available today. Each has its toughness and weaknesses, making the choice of structure a critical choice for any job.

In this write-up, we'll compare Ruby on Rails with various other leading frameworks, examining vital factors like development speed, scalability, performance, and neighborhood support.

1. Development Speed

Rails is renowned for its rapid development abilities. Its convention-over-configuration approach minimizes decision-making, enabling developers to focus on building functions instead of setting up configurations.

Django: Like Rails, Django supplies high growth rate many thanks to its "batteries-included" viewpoint, supplying built-in tools for typical tasks.
Laravel: Laravel is developer-friendly yet might need additional arrangement for jobs that Rails handles out of package.
Node.js: While Node.js is extremely flexible, its modular nature suggests designers frequently hang out selecting and setting up third-party libraries.

2. Scalability

Scalability is crucial for applications anticipating high individual growth.

Rails: Bed rails sustains horizontal scaling through data source optimizations and history handling tools like Sidekiq. Real-world examples like Shopify display its scalability.
Django: Django likewise scales well, particularly for read-heavy applications, many thanks to its caching abilities.
Laravel: Laravel is suitable for tiny to medium-scale applications yet may require more effort to range for enterprise-level projects.
Node.js: Node.js masters dealing with real-time applications, such as chat apps or streaming services, making it extremely scalable.

3. Performance

Performance usually depends on the details use situation.

Bed rails: Rails has actually boosted efficiency throughout the years, yet it may not match the rate of structures like Node.js in handling real-time interactions.
Django: Django uses strong performance however can lag in managing asynchronous jobs compared to Node.js.
Laravel: Laravel's performance is comparable to Rails however might call for added optimization for high-traffic applications.
Node.js: Node.js beats others in real-time and asynchronous efficiency due to its non-blocking I/O design.
